Ukrainian products on the Persian Gulf market: UFMA trade mission to the UAE brought together business, government and international partners

From 26 to 30 January 2026, Abu Dhabi and Dubai hosted the UFMA trade mission to the United Arab Emirates, which became an important platform for promoting Ukrainian food products in the Persian Gulf market.

As part of the mission, 30 Ukrainian companies presented over 200 SKUs of products to the target market. For the first time in Abu Dhabi, a permanent exhibition of Ukrainian products was opened at the Ukrainian Embassy in the UAE, intended for presentations to potential partners, importers and distributors.

Among the key results were negotiations with representatives of Majid Al Futtaim, the operator of the Carrefour chain, as well as SAVA in the UAE. The companies confirmed their interest in Ukrainian products ready for export. The mission participants also established direct contacts with local importers and distributors for further cooperation.

The practical part of the mission included store visits to key retail chains in the UAE, as well as a visit to the flagship international exhibition Gulfood-2026, which took place in Dubai during the same period.

An important event was the business forum ‘Ukraine and the UAE: Expanding the Horizons of Mutual Trade and Investment,’ organised by the Ukrainian Business Council under the leadership of President Olena Shyrokova and with the support of the Embassy of Ukraine in the UAE. The forum demonstrated the synergy between the public and private sectors and opened up opportunities for Emirati partners in contract manufacturing, export and joint investment in the food industry.

The mission was organised by UFMA in cooperation with the Embassy of Ukraine in the UAE, the Office for Entrepreneurship and Export Development, the national project Dія.Бізнес, the international platform Nazovni.online, with the support of the Swiss Import Promotion Programme SIPPO, Mercy Corps Ukraine, and the companies Meest and Oliyar.

The organisers acknowledge the contribution of international and Ukrainian partners, in particular SIPPO, for its thorough preparation of participants and in-depth analysis of the UAE market, as well as the Embassy of Ukraine in the UAE for its active diplomatic support and creation of a powerful space for business networking.
